Armenian director

Born in 1984 in Armenia, she studied in Department of Informatics and applied mathematics at Yerevan State University. Then, she studied in Studio of acting and directing at Armenian National Film Center and she discovered documentary film with Ateliers Varan in 2006. She's currently working in National Leadership Institute as filmmaker, videographer and editor.
